April 30, 201016 yr Hi,We are pulling the weather for VHHH, but I suggest that the database entry is wrong for the airport. We must use the default data, so that may be the problem here. Yes, it is!Go to the edit weather stations tab and load the Data Stations file. Find VHHH on the list and edit the Lat to 22.309 and the Long to 113.915. Save the edit and restart ASE and if you go to VHHH that is what will show up in ASE.
